问答题
简答题
请写出下列递归算法的功能。
typedef struct node{
datatype data;
struct node *link;
} *LinkList;
int ALGORISM(LinkList list)
{
if(list==NULL)
return 0;
else
return 1+ALGORISM(list->link);
}
【参考答案】
计算由list所指的线性链表的长度。
点击查看答案
